Subject: Dark mode — know before you're paged

Welcome to the Brindlewatch admin dashboard rotation. Dark mode is a theme-token overlay, not separate stylesheets. Most pages inherit tokens cleanly; the legacy billing screens do not, so a "white flash" report there is known behavior, not an incident. Never hotfix token values directly — they're generated at build time and will be overwritten. Theme architecture, token map, and the exception list are on the internal page.

runbook for kageg-yafof: https://jira.norvalabs.test/board/view/secrets/job/ticket/board/board/2bc6c981aafb1e8fe00a8459

### Changed defaults

The Quillback transcoding farm now defaults to two-pass encoding for all 1080p jobs and caps concurrent segments per worker at a lower value to reduce memory pressure seen last sprint. Older presets remain available behind a flag. Review the diff carefully since downstream queue sizing assumptions may change. The new default values are listed below.

service settings:
PRAIX_LOG_LEVEL=error
PRAIX_METRICS_HOST=metrics.praix.qorvelcorp.corp
PRAIX_POOL_SIZE=16

Rotated the Larkspire artifact-signing keypair following the clock-skew incident in the Ostmere build farm. Agents with drift beyond 30 seconds had produced signatures with timestamps outside the validity window, causing intermittent verification failures downstream. All agents now enforce NTP sync at job start and abort on skew above 5 seconds. The previous key has been revoked; artifacts signed before this date must be re-verified against the archived chain. All new releases validate against the replacement signing key provided below.

deploy key for kajof-fajop: bky6_gDHw9Q